## Onboarding: Fareweight Rules Engine

Fareweight computes shipping fees from stacked rule sets. Rules are versioned; never edit a live version. Deploys go through the staging evaluator first. Read the rule DSL guide before touching anything.

Rule definitions live in the pricing database — connect to it with the connection string below.

primary connection of yagep-bajop = postgresql://druiel_svc:gW@db-3860.sivrelworks.example:5432/brieth

## Runbook: Account Recovery via RotaKey

RotaKey is Fennelworks' internal secrets-rotation utility. If an on-call account is locked after a failed rotation, run the recovery subcommand from a trusted bastion and confirm the audit prompt. The tool will then ask for the team recovery passphrase, which is provided here for convenience.

vault phrase of bagaf-kajeg = jorath-feniel-briir-siliel-ralix

Ticket: TilePull prefetcher — prod config drifted from approved baseline

Heads up for security review: the map-tile prefetcher (TilePull) in prod no longer matches the baseline we signed off in Q2. Someone widened the fetch concurrency and loosened the origin allowlist. Needs a look before the audit. What's actually running right now is this.

service settings:
[silwyn]
host = silwyn.crelvogrid.internal
user = silwyn_svc
database = silwyn_prod